Defence Minister Tagarev Accepts Resignation of Advisor Emin

Defence Minister Todor Tagarev told journalists Wednesday he has accepted the resignation of one of his advisors in the Defence Ministry – Mustafa Emin. In his words, Emin decided to resign to avoid creating bottlenecks in the work of the Ministry and the cabinet.

Emin and the Defence Minister have recently come under pressure after a nurse in Sofia's Pirogov emergency hospital complained in a Facebook post that Emin used his position to secure preferential treatment for his child, who was with a minor injury, and threatened the hospital staff when they refused to do as asked. The nurse's post was reposted by the Pirogov Hospital, whose management said that the staff involved in the episode, acted by the established rules of procedure and while the minister's advisor did not act aggressively, he was verbally abusive.

In a letter, Tagarev asked Health Minister Hristo Hinkov to launch an inquiry into the case. The event was also the subject of comments in Parliament. Kostadin Angelov - Healthcare Committee Chairperson, and Hristo Gadzhev – Defence Committee Chairperson, demanded a reaction from Prime Minister Nikolay Denkov. Vazrazhdane also demanded the resignation of Minister Tagarev over what happened at the Pirogov Hospital.

Meanwhile, Emin said he would "defend his name and make sure to prove the truth about his communication with the Pirogov Hospital staff". He says he has become the target of a smear campaign and warns that "such campaigns will intensify and aim to undermine people's confidence, cause conflicts and provoke aggression".  He calls on people to stand up against this threat.
